The working principle is as follows:
first will wash the dish material loading machine and remove the next door in vegetable washing pond, then adjust suitable position with material loading machine main part 1 through adjustment mechanism 7, start first conveyer belt 2 and second conveyer belt 5, discharge gate through material loading machine main part 1 top is put the salted vegetables on first conveyer belt 2, first conveyer belt 2 drives the salted vegetables and removes and enter into on the second conveyer belt 5 to first swash plate 3, extrusion device 4 extrudees the moisture in the salted vegetables, moisture is arranged other places along the drain pipe at 1 top of material loading case, second conveyer belt 5 drives the salted vegetables that the extrusion finishes and enters into next step along second swash plate 6, specific accommodation process is as follows:
1. the adjusting process comprises the following steps:
the motor 701 is connected with an external power supply, the motor 701 drives the bevel gear set 702 to rotate, the bevel gear set 702 drives the threaded rod 703 to rotate, the threaded rod 703 drives the threaded block 704 to move, the threaded block 704 drives the connecting block 705 to slide in the vertical rod 706, the threaded block 704 drives the upright post 8 to move so as to drive the concave block 10 and further drive the feeding machine main body 1 to move, when the feeding machine main body 1 moves to a proper position, the motor 701 is stopped, the motor 701 is rotated in the opposite direction, the feeding machine main body 1 returns to an initial position, when the height of a feeding hole of the feeding machine main body 1 needs to be adjusted, the motor 701 at the right end is started, when the outlet position of the feeding machine main body 1 needs to be adjusted, the left end motor 701 is started, when the height of the feeding machine main body 1 needs to be adjusted, the two motors 701 are started simultaneously.
